Tips for Maintaining Your Pontiac Firebird Tires
Proper tire maintenance extends the life of your tires and ensures your Firebird performs at its best. Regularly check tire pressure, rotate your tires every 5,000 to 7,000 miles, and inspect for uneven wear or damage. Investing in quality tires and timely maintenance can prevent handling issues and improve fuel efficiency.
